Subject: WanderTone cut-over — done!

Hey all,

The WanderTone audio-guide backend is now fully on the new Larkfield cluster. Cut-over happened Tuesday night with about four minutes of downtime — visitors at the Hollowbrook Museum pilot didn't even notice. Old Brimley boxes are drained and will be decommissioned next month. Tour playlists, offline bundles, and beacon triggers all verified by Priya's smoke tests. One gotcha: the CDN warm-up takes ~10 minutes after a deploy. For reference, here are the service's current configuration values.

deployment values, yadug-bawif:
[framir]
team = pelox
access_code = ac_a38ab2
owner = tamion.julael
host = framir.tolvaqlabs.test
port = 11211
peer = tammir.zemvargrid.local
salt = 2215ef03
pin = 1541

Glimmerkit renders plugin components headlessly and diffs snapshots against the baseline store. Plugin authors must set `GLIMMER_SNAP_DIR` to a writable path and `GLIMMER_BASELINE_BRANCH` to your integration branch. Snapshots upload to the Varnholt baseline service on every CI run; stale baselines are pruned after 30 days. Do not commit snapshot artifacts. Flaky diffs usually mean unseeded randomness — set `GLIMMER_SEED=1`. Uploads require authentication, so add the following line to your `.env.test` file:

sealed setting: ARCHIVE_KEY3=8d0

Welcome! Spindlevault is our homegrown secrets-rotation tool, and yes, it has its own little database. It tracks which credentials are due for rotation, who triggered what, and whether a rotation actually stuck. Don't confuse it with the main secrets store — Spindlevault only holds metadata, never actual secret values. As a contractor you'll mostly read from the rotation-history tables when debugging failed rotations. For local poking around, connect to the metadata store with the connection string below.

primary connection of yagep-kahip = redis://giliel_svc:zYiKsLL2PLpfPL@db-348f.xolmarsys.corp:5432/fenwyn